Transaction

ee670f2c2fcc86cc14e45ae0bb323e36ca44d8ebf84d9a98e02aabe9a0dddaa6
302,223 confirmations
Timestamp
1594031769
Block637,957
Fee2,011 sats
Fee rate3 sats/vB
view on mempool.space

Inputs & Outputs